Big Red breaks out big bats in 24-4 win
Placeholder Image
All eleven players who stepped on the field for the Gainesville baseball team Monday at Johnson had at least one hit as the Red Elephants defeated the Knights 24-4.  

Will Maddox went 4-for-4 with eight RBIs and two home runs to lead the Red Elephants at the plate.

Steven Mason went 4-for-5 with three runs scored and three RBIs, Sloan Strickland went 1-for-2 with three RBIs and a home run, Hunter Anglin went 2-for-4 with four RBIs and a home run and Anderson Loggins went 3-for-3 with four runs scored and two RBIs for Gainesville (22-1, 17-0 Region 7B-AAA).

K.J. McAllister went 3-for-5 with two runs scored and two RBIs while stealing two bases to give him a total of 31 on the season for Gainesville.

Ryan Griffith pitched a complete game with seven strikeouts for the Red Elephants, who play host to Creekview at 7 p.m. Wednesday for the Region 7-AAA championship.

Johnson (10-12, 8-9 Region 7B-AAA) plays host to Gilmer at 5:55 p.m. Wednesday for Senior Night.

LAMBERT 12, FLOWERY BRANCH 2: Corey Sanderson went 3-for-3 with an RBI to lead Flowery Branch in a six-inning loss Monday at Lambert.

Flowery Branch (5-19, 5-13 Region 7B-AAA) plays host to Lumpkin County at 5:55 p.m. for its season finale.

LUMPKIN COUNTY 13, PICKENS 3: Jonathan Whitehead had four hits, two home runs and five RBIs to lead Lumpkin County to the win Monday in Jasper.

Chad Fulton added four hits for the Indians (9-15, 8-9 Region 7A-AAA) who travel to Flowery Branch at 5:55 p.m. Wednesday.

RIVERSIDE 7, EAST JACKSON 6 (FRIDAY):  Brian Cox hit a two-run home run in the top of the seventh inning to give Riverside the eventual win on Friday in Commerce in game one of a doubleheader.

RIVERSIDE 11, EAST JACKSON 10 (FRIDAY): John Walker hit a three-run home run to lead the Eagles to the doubleheader sweep Friday in Commerce.

Michael Crespo went 3-for-5 with two doubles and two RBIs for Riverside which plays host to Rabun County at 5 p.m. today.
